Transaction 330143085cf7e0d42aa0cbb835077442cc8a69f34e1dda5c3d727a106bdbc25d
1 Input
1 Output
-
330143085cf7e0d42aa0cbb835077442cc8a69f34e1dda5c3d727a106bdbc25d:0
- value
- 595830
- script pubkey
- OP_0 OP_PUSHBYTES_20 acc2c0ffd7274e1ce3498323334742ab02c92a2e
- address
- bc1q4npvpl7hya8pec6fsv3nx36z4vpvj23w6g95ac